What is Grasshopper Pie?

Before we get to the recipe, let’s take a moment to appreciate the history of this unique pie. While its origins are debated, grasshopper pie is believed to have emerged in the mid-20th century in the United States. Some stories link its creation to a restaurant in the Midwest, while others suggest it was a popular dessert served at soda fountains.

The pie’s name comes from its signature green hue, achieved by blending crème de menthe liqueur into the creamy filling. The result is a visually striking dessert with a cool, minty flavor that’s both refreshing and indulgent.

Ingredients You’ll Need:

For the Crust:

  • 1 1/2 cups chocolate cookie crumbs (such as Oreos)
  • 5 tablespoons unsalted butter, melted

For the Filling:

  • 1 (14 ounce) can sweetened condensed milk
  • 1/2 cup heavy cream
  • 1/4 cup crème de menthe liqueur
  • 1/4 cup white crème de cacao liqueur
  • 1/4 teaspoon peppermint extract (optional, for enhanced mint flavor)
  • Green food coloring (optional, for a more vibrant color)

For the Topping:

  • 1 cup heavy cream
  • 2 tablespoons powdered sugar
  • Chocolate shavings (for garnish)
  • Fresh mint leaves (for garnish)

Equipment You’ll Need:

  • 9-inch pie plate
  • Food processor (or a zip-top bag and rolling pin for crushing cookies)
  • Mixing bowls
  • Electric mixer
  • Rubber spatula
  • Measuring cups and spoons
